Cheap Radar Detector Range.
Range is everything when it comes to radar detectors because a device that doesn't pick up a radar gun soon enough means you won't have time to slow down before getting nabbed.By way of example, Radar Test clocked our two choices for best cheap radar detectors, the Beltronics Vector 955 (starting at $139, Amazon) and Whistler XTR 695SE (starting at $152, Amazon
), at 28,000 feet and just under 25,000 feet, respectively, for X-, K- and KA-band frequencies (see discussion of bands below). The same site also clocked the Cobra XRS 9955, one of our picks for good cheap radar detector, at just under 25,000 feet; the Cobra XRS 9945 (starting at $122, Amazon
), the other good cheap radar detector on our list, averages about 30,000 feet for the K and KA bands, although the older X band is detected only at about 10,000 feet. An older Beltronics model, the Vector 940 (starting at $140, Amazon
) has been noted to pick up signals at about 10,000 feet, while the Rocky Mountain Radar RMR-C435 (starting at $125, Amazon
) has produced similar results.
Radar Detectors Alerts.
If you can't see or hear the alerts from a radar detector, then it's not very effective. All the detectors on our list come with some sort of audio alert, be it a loud beep or a voice signal. Some cheap radar detectors, like the Beltronics Vector 955, Whistler XTR-695SE, and Cobra XRS 9955, have a voice-activated feature. Others, like the Beltronics V940 and Rocky Mountain Radar RMR-C435, feature just tone (beep) recognition. Some cheap radar detectors also feature an audio output that allows users who are riding motorcycles or driving convertibles to plug the device into their speaker systems. The Whistler XTR-695SE provides this capability.Radar detectors also use their display to alert drivers. Each of the cheap radar detectors on our list features an LCD screen that displays the type of alert it's meant to pick up. But a safety heads-up here: you shouldn't be keeping an eye on your detector when driving, which is why audio alerts are so critical.
